Summary
Multiple public commenters urged council to add $600,000 in FY26 budget to restore before- and after-school care at Jaycox Elementary, saying the school's 9 a.m. start time leaves young children unsupervised and strains working families.
Speakers at Norfolk's public hearing asked the city to prioritize $600,000 to restore before- and after-school care at Jaycox Elementary School.
